Can a machine that writes fluent sentences also do physics? Sarah Demers, who chairs Yale University's physics department and hunts for signals of the Higgs boson at CERN, is asking what skills survive as large language models enter research labs.

The facts

  • 1Sarah Demers chairs the physics department at Yale University and works on the ATLAS experiment at CERN's Large Hadron Collider.
  • 2She is examining how large language models are entering physics, noting the tools can both speed up and undermine careful research work.
  • 3ATLAS is one of the LHC's largest detectors, run by a collaboration of roughly 3,000 physicists from more than 40 countries.
  • 4Large language models can draft code, summarize papers, and suggest hypotheses quickly, but they can also produce confident-sounding errors that go unchecked without expert review.
  • 5Demers's concern reflects a wider debate among scientists about which human skills, like judgment and skepticism, remain essential as AI tools spread through research.

Why it matters

As AI tools spread into labs worldwide, the debate over which human skills matter most could shape how future discoveries, from particle physics to medicine, are checked and trusted.
